Can a faulty radiator cap cause coolant leaks?

A faulty radiator cap can indeed cause coolant leaks, leading to engine overheating and potential damage. The radiator cap plays a crucial role in maintaining the correct pressure in the cooling system, and if it fails, it can result in coolant escaping. How Does a Radiator Cap Work?

The radiator cap is more than just a lid; it’s a pressure-release valve that helps maintain the optimal pressure in the cooling system. By sealing the radiator, it ensures that the coolant remains under pressure, which raises the boiling point of the coolant, preventing it from boiling over. This is crucial for efficient engine cooling.

  • Pressure Maintenance: The cap maintains the cooling system pressure, typically between 13 to 16 psi, depending on the vehicle.
  • Safety Valve: It acts as a safety valve, releasing pressure if it exceeds the system’s capacity to prevent damage.
  • Coolant Recovery: It allows excess coolant to flow into the overflow tank and back into the radiator as needed.

What Happens When a Radiator Cap Fails?

A failing radiator cap can lead to several issues, including coolant leaks, overheating, and even engine damage. Here’s how:

  • Pressure Loss: If the cap can’t maintain pressure, the coolant may boil and evaporate, leading to a loss of coolant.
  • Coolant Overflow: A faulty cap might not seal properly, causing coolant to escape into the overflow tank or out of the system.
  • Overheating: Without the correct pressure, the cooling system won’t function efficiently, potentially causing the engine to overheat.

Symptoms of a Faulty Radiator Cap

Identifying a faulty radiator cap early can prevent more serious issues. Look for these symptoms:

  • Coolant Leaks: Visible puddles under the vehicle or around the radiator cap.
  • Overheating Engine: The temperature gauge indicates the engine is running hotter than normal.
  • Collapsed Radiator Hoses: Lack of pressure might cause hoses to collapse.
  • Steam or Coolant Smell: Steam from the hood or a sweet smell indicates a coolant leak.

How to Test a Radiator Cap

Testing your radiator cap can help confirm if it’s the source of the problem. Here’s a simple method:

  1. Visual Inspection: Check for visible damage like cracks or worn seals.
  2. Pressure Test: Use a radiator cap tester to check if it holds the correct pressure.
  3. Professional Inspection: If unsure, have a mechanic perform a thorough check.

Replacing a Faulty Radiator Cap

Replacing a faulty radiator cap is a simple and cost-effective solution. Follow these steps:

  1. Purchase the Correct Cap: Ensure you buy a cap that matches your vehicle’s specifications.
  2. Cool the Engine: Always let the engine cool before removing the radiator cap to avoid burns.
  3. Remove the Old Cap: Twist the cap counterclockwise to remove it.
  4. Install the New Cap: Place the new cap and twist it clockwise until it’s secure.

How Often Should You Check Your Radiator Cap?

Regular maintenance is key to vehicle health. Check your radiator cap during routine oil changes or if you notice any symptoms of failure. Replacing it every few years or as recommended by your vehicle’s manufacturer is a good practice.

Can a Bad Radiator Cap Cause Overheating?

Yes, a bad radiator cap can cause overheating by not maintaining the correct pressure in the cooling system, leading to coolant loss and reduced cooling efficiency.

How Do I Know If My Radiator Cap Is Bad?

Signs of a bad radiator cap include coolant leaks, an overheating engine, collapsed hoses, and the smell of coolant. Performing a pressure test can help confirm the issue.

Can I Drive With a Faulty Radiator Cap?

Driving with a faulty radiator cap is not recommended, as it can lead to overheating and engine damage. It’s best to replace the cap as soon as possible.

What Is the Cost of Replacing a Radiator Cap?

The cost of replacing a radiator cap is relatively low, typically ranging from $10 to $30, depending on the vehicle and the cap’s specifications.

Does a Radiator Cap Affect Fuel Efficiency?

While a radiator cap doesn’t directly affect fuel efficiency, overheating due to a faulty cap can lead to engine inefficiency, indirectly affecting fuel consumption.
